Two days in Heaven (Madulsima to Pitamaruwa)

I have heard and seen some stunning images of a waterfall in a rural village in Uva long ago and I was tempted to visit this waterfall which is the 3rd highest in Uva and winning the 7th place considering all other waterfalls in Sri Lanka. So again it was a gamble with overcast conditions. First day I decided to spend the night at a friend’s place close to Madulsima.

Leopard Hunt – Three Day Trip to Yala National Park – Block 1

We met 2 wild elephants on the road from Yala junction to Yala entrance. Van driver was so scared and we had to speak him through to reach the entrance. We reached the entrance by 6a.m. then our jeep came. Mr. Rupasinghe ( 0718424056- we highly recommend him .awesome person with 28 years of experience) in his old Land Rover. Jeep’s running condition is superb comparing to Indian jeeps which chases the animals away due to their sounds of the engines!!!

Ampara to Pulukunawa along A27 in search of Heritage

On a peaceful day I arrived at Ampara and took the Maha Oya road towards Piyangala junction and got down near the temple. There were a fleet of steps which took me towards a well-built “Kutiya” with an inscription. At that time there were about 100 visitors howling around forgetting that this was a monastery where monks meditated.

“අවාරේ සිරිපා කරුනාව” – Murraywatta/Rajamale

We started our Journey early in the morning, had our Breakfast on the way. Since the weather was good we did not have any problems in the way. You have to turn to left just passing the Mohini Ella (15 Km sign is there near the Turn) to enter in to Murray estate, You have to travel about 8 kms to reach the Rajamale which is the border of the Siripa forest reserve.

Climbing Raxagala රාක්ශගල (1438m)

Raxagala is the second highest peak of Dolosbage range and having different names. Locals called it Kinihira (කිනිහිර), Paththini amma kanda (පත්තිනි අම්මා කන්ද), Wangedi molgas gala (වන්ගෙඩි මොල්ගස් ගල )1: 50000Map shows it as Stentry box east. The idea of climbing this unusual shaped mountain came into my mind when I climbed Kabaragala-higest peak of Dolosbage range.When I searched it, I found a nice article in Sri lankan travellers. It gave me a good guidance.

Visit to the Historical Rajamaha viharayas in and around Raigam Koralaya ( Bandaragama) And Kodigaha Kanda forest sanctuary

Raigama, according to some historians, was the seventh capital of ancient Lanka, after Anuradhapura (4th century BC – 10th century AD), Polonnaruwa (10th century – mid-13th century), Dambadeniya (1232–72), Yapahuwa (1272–93), Kurunegala (1293–1341) and Gampola (1341–47). It is said to have been the capital for 68 years, until Parakramabahu VI moved to the comforts of Sri Jayawardenepura-Kotte in 1415 (Wikipedia.)
